The Surprisingly Simple Dentition of the Aardvark
Unlike humans and many other mammals with a complex set of incisors, canines, premolars, and molars, the aardvark boasts a surprisingly simple dentition. Instead of differentiated teeth, the aardvark possesses a relatively small number of simple, continuously growing teeth. This unique dental structure is perfectly adapted to its specialized diet of insects.
The exact number of teeth an aardvark has can vary slightly, depending on age and individual variations. However, a general consensus among scientists places the total number within a specific range.
The Typical Aardvark Tooth Count: A Closer Look
Adult aardvarks typically possess between 20 and 40 teeth, with significant variations observed. There is no fixed number per quadrant of the jaw as many mammalian dentitions exhibit. The teeth themselves lack enamel and are composed primarily of dentine, which is covered in a layer of cementum. This unique structure is crucial for their function, as we'll discuss later.
Key takeaway: While the exact count isn't fixed, thinking of the aardvark's tooth count as roughly between 20 and 40 provides a solid estimate.
The Structure and Function of Aardvark Teeth: A Unique Adaptation
The structure of the aardvark's teeth is remarkably different from the specialized teeth of other mammals. Their lack of enamel, the hard outer layer found on most mammalian teeth, is a key distinguishing feature. This lack of enamel isn't a deficiency; it's an adaptation directly related to their diet.
Continuous Growth: A Lifelong Supply
The continuous growth of aardvark teeth is a critical adaptation for their insect-rich diet. Because they constantly grind their teeth against the hard exoskeletons of ants and termites, the teeth wear down over time. This continuous growth ensures a lifelong supply of functional teeth, allowing them to effectively process their food.
The Role of Dentine and Cementum: Ensuring Durability
The composition of aardvark teeth—primarily dentine covered by cementum—plays a vital role in their durability and function. Dentine is a relatively softer tissue than enamel, but it's still strong enough to withstand the constant abrasion caused by consuming insects. Cementum, a bony substance, protects the dentine and contributes to the tooth's overall structure.
Absence of Enamel: An Evolutionary Advantage
The absence of enamel, while seemingly a disadvantage, is actually a significant evolutionary adaptation. Enamel is brittle and could easily chip or break under the constant grinding action of consuming ants and termites. The softer dentine, combined with the protective cementum layer, provides a more resilient and adaptive dental structure perfectly suited to their diet.
